#### Introduction

Keeping spiders as pets can be an exciting and rewarding experience for many enthusiasts. Unlike traditional pets like cats or dogs, spiders offer a unique perspective on the world of arachnids. This guide will explore the ins and outs of spiders as pets, including their care, habitat, and the benefits of having them as companions.

#### Why Choose Spiders as Pets?

Many people wonder why they should consider spiders as pets. Spiders are low-maintenance, require minimal space, and are fascinating to observe. They have unique behaviors and characteristics that can be both educational and entertaining. For those who are allergic to furry pets or live in smaller spaces, spiders can be an ideal choice.

#### Types of Spiders Suitable for Pets

When it comes to spiders as pets, not all species are created equal. Some of the most popular types include:

1. **Tarantulas**: These are the most commonly kept spiders. They come in various colors and sizes, and their docile nature makes them suitable for beginners.

2. **Jumping Spiders**: Known for their playful behavior and excellent vision, jumping spiders are small and can be very interactive.

3. **Wolf Spiders**: These spiders are larger and more active, making them interesting to watch as they hunt.

4. **Goliath Birdeater**: For those seeking a more exotic pet, the Goliath Birdeater is one of the largest spiders in the world, though it requires more experience to care for.

#### Setting Up a Habitat

Creating a suitable habitat is crucial for the health and well-being of your spiders as pets. Here are some essential components to consider:

- **Enclosure**: A glass terrarium or plastic container with ventilation is ideal. The size will depend on the type of spider you choose.

- **Substrate**: Use coconut fiber, peat moss, or soil to provide a comfortable burrowing environment.

- **Hiding Spots**: Spiders need places to hide, so include items like cork bark, rocks, or artificial plants.

- **Temperature and Humidity**: Each species has specific requirements, so research your spider’s needs to maintain the right conditions.

#### Feeding Your Spider

Feeding is another critical aspect of keeping spiders as pets. Most spiders eat live insects, such as crickets, mealworms, or roaches. It’s essential to provide the right size prey—too large can stress your spider, while too small may not provide adequate nutrition.

#### Handling and Interaction

While some spiders can be handled, it’s essential to approach this with caution. Many species are skittish and may bite if threatened. If you decide to handle your spider, do so gently and ensure that you are in a safe environment to prevent escapes or injuries.

#### Benefits of Keeping Spiders

Having spiders as pets comes with several benefits. They require less daily attention than traditional pets, making them perfect for busy individuals. Additionally, they can help control insect populations in your home, acting as a natural pest control method. Observing their behaviors can also provide insight into their fascinating lives and contribute to a deeper appreciation for biodiversity.
